Benfica announced the signing of Claudio Echeverri as a reinforcement for the team in the summer market, arriving on loan from Manchester City. The Argentine attacking midfielder needed only a few minutes on the pitch to leave good impressions and earn the trust of coach Marco Silva.
Echeverri made his debut for the Eagles' first team in the match against Gil Vicente, which ended in a 3-1 victory. The young Argentine's display did not go unnoticed, and Marco Silva made a point of publicly praising his new player.
The Benfica coach highlighted that Echeverri managed to be decisive at a crucial moment in the game when he was called upon to enter, taking on responsibilities in the position where he needed to be decisive. Marco Silva also emphasized the personality demonstrated by the Argentine player.
